Quick CI note before the sync: incremental rebuilds on the Marblewick docs site have been flaky since we bumped the Quillgen cache layer. Pages touched by shared partials sometimes skip regeneration, so stale nav links ship to staging. Workaround for now: nuke the .quillcache dir in the pipeline and eat the full rebuild (~9 min). Tovah is adding partial-dependency tracking next sprint, so don't paper over it locally. If you hit this, grab the failing run and paste its token below.

session token of tajef-bageg = htk21_5d90d574934f3ccae6437

# Hatchmark KV — Environments

Hatchmark runs a bloom filter in front of its key-value store in every environment, which is why a miss returns faster than a hit. Support staff: false positives are expected and harmless, but a rising false-positive rate in staging usually means the filter needs resizing. The staging environment currently runs with these values.

settings of fafog-haduf:
ZORIX_PIN=4648
ZORIX_METRICS_HOST=metrics.zorix.paliqsys.corp
ZORIX_LOG_LEVEL=info
ZORIX_TENANT=druix

## Deployment: Template Rendering

Quillmark pre-compiles templates at boot; first-request stalls mean the warmup step was skipped. Keep the render cache on one node per pod — sharing it across pods causes eviction churn. If p95 render time exceeds 40ms, check cache hit rate before scaling. Support should verify the deployed environment uses the following configuration values.

deployment values, yadup-kadug:
[sorys]
port = 5672
team = noveth
host = sorys.orvexcorp.example
region = south-4
access_code = ac_deddc1
timeout_ms = 1500

Subject: CycleShift handover before my leave

Handing CycleShift, the bike-share rebalancing tool for the Verlane docks, over to on-call. Releases go out Tuesdays; the solver and dispatcher deploy as one unit. If the rebalancing queue stalls, restart the planner first. Hotfix deploys must be signed manually since the runner can't reach the vault from the on-call laptop. The deploy key for that is:

deploy key for kajof-fajop: bky6_gDHw9Q